请详细介绍在VxWorks 5.3版本环境下配置WindRiver Media Library SDK的详细步骤,并确保在开发过程中妥善管理第三方商标和许可证信息。
时间: 2024-10-31 10:14:09 浏览: 24
要在VxWorks平台下成功配置并使用WindRiver Media Library SDK,首先需要确保你已经获取了合法的许可证,并且遵守了所有的版权和第三方商标使用规定。以下是配置WRML SDK的步骤:
参考资源链接:[VxWorks Qt配置:WindRiver Media Library SDK程序员指南](https://wenku.csdn.net/doc/5e7rg3ipo1?spm=1055.2569.3001.10343)
1. **准备工作**:在开始配置之前,需要检查VxWorks的系统需求和兼容性,确保你的开发环境满足WRML SDK的要求。这包括了硬件平台、操作系统版本以及必要的网络配置。
2. **下载与安装**:登录WindRiver官方网站或授权渠道下载SDK的安装文件。根据官方提供的安装指南执行安装步骤,确保所有组件正确安装。
3. **配置环境**:根据《VxWorks Qt配置:WindRiver Media Library SDK程序员指南》中的指导,设置环境变量以包含SDK的路径。这对于编译器和链接器能够找到WRML的头文件和库文件至关重要。
4. **集成第三方组件**:如果你的应用程序需要使用到第三方库,确保你已经拥有适当的许可证,并且按照指南中的说明进行配置。
5. **许可证管理**:在开发过程中,确保所有的第三方组件和库都已记录并且在开发文档中有适当的引用。这将帮助你避免可能的法律问题,并确保项目符合许可要求。
6. **API集成**:参考技术文档,了解如何使用WRML提供的API进行多媒体数据的处理。你需要编写代码来加载、处理、解码、编码和流化媒体内容,并确保这些操作符合第三方的许可协议。
7. **代码编写与测试**:按照WRML SDK的示例代码,开始你的多媒体应用开发。在开发过程中,编写单元测试和集成测试,以验证功能的正确性并确保代码质量。
8. **文档与合规性**:在项目文档中详细记录使用到的第三方库和组件,以及如何处理版权和许可证信息。确保所有的文档和代码中都有适当的注释和引用。
9. **技术支持**:如果在配置或开发过程中遇到问题,参考官方文档或者联系WindRiver的技术支持获取帮助。
在遵循上述步骤的同时,确保你已经阅读并理解了《VxWorks Qt配置:WindRiver Media Library SDK程序员指南》中关于安全和版权管理的章节,以确保你的开发过程符合法律要求和许可证规定。
参考资源链接:[VxWorks Qt配置:WindRiver Media Library SDK程序员指南](https://wenku.csdn.net/doc/5e7rg3ipo1?spm=1055.2569.3001.10343)
阅读全文